gnunet-svn
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[GNUnet-SVN] r16690 - gnunet/src/transport


From: gnunet
Subject: [GNUnet-SVN] r16690 - gnunet/src/transport
Date: Fri, 2 Sep 2011 15:08:37 +0200

Author: grothoff
Date: 2011-09-02 15:08:37 +0200 (Fri, 02 Sep 2011)
New Revision: 16690

Modified:
   gnunet/src/transport/gnunet-service-transport_neighbours.c
Log:
making mwachs happy

Modified: gnunet/src/transport/gnunet-service-transport_neighbours.c
===================================================================
--- gnunet/src/transport/gnunet-service-transport_neighbours.c  2011-09-02 
13:01:15 UTC (rev 16689)
+++ gnunet/src/transport/gnunet-service-transport_neighbours.c  2011-09-02 
13:08:37 UTC (rev 16690)
@@ -569,14 +569,16 @@
                            uint32_t ats_count)
 {
   struct NeighbourMapEntry *n = cls;
+  int was_connected;
 
   n->asc = NULL;
+  was_connected = n->is_connected;
+  n->is_connected = GNUNET_YES;
   GST_neighbours_switch_to_address (target, plugin_name, plugin_address,
                                     plugin_address_len, session, ats,
                                     ats_count);
-  if (GNUNET_YES == n->is_connected)
+  if (GNUNET_YES == was_connected)
     return;
-  n->is_connected = GNUNET_YES;
   connect_notify_cb (callback_cls, target, n->ats, n->ats_count);
 }
 
@@ -698,7 +700,7 @@
   {
     GNUNET_STATISTICS_update (GST_stats,
                               gettext_noop
-                              ("# SET QUOTA messages ignored (no such peer)"),
+                              ("# messages not sent (no such peer or not 
connected)"),
                               1, GNUNET_NO);
 #if DEBUG_TRANSPORT
     if (n == NULL)




reply via email to

[Prev in Thread] Current Thread [Next in Thread]